你查询的IP:[119.78.170.30]  地理位置:中国科技网

最新查询117.21.83.96 218.94.190.70 120.254.91.144 117.121.196.236 59.64.169.174 222.248.189.241 219.244.237.243 124.172.185.17 60.146.13.237 119.78.170.30 203.119.32.55 61.28.242.57 119.18.192.176 114.28.45.29 203.83.56.206 117.8.0.35 120.64.38.240 60.63.105.64 202.74.8.105 203.100.192.213 121.32.76.4 202.120.23.60 123.180.78.77 122.136.135.145 116.89.144.156 202.173.8.57 121.51.140.97 121.52.208.176 202.149.224.133 202.38.168.196 220.160.225.106